PERIODIC SOLUTIONS OF LINEAR NEUTRAL INTEGRO-DIFFERENTIAL EQUATIONS

Abstract:

Consider the linear neutral FDE
d
dt
[x(t) + Ax(t −  )] = ZR
[dL(s)]x(t + s) + f(t)
where x and f are n-dimensional vectors; A is an n×n constant matrix and L(s) is an n×n
matrix function with bounded total variation. Some necessary and sufficient conditions
are given which guarantee the existence and uniqueness of periodic solutions to the above
equation.
